ORCS Funding Can Help Build your EV Charging Infrastructure 

The On-street Residential charge point Scheme (ORCS) provides grant funding for local authorities to install residential on-street charge points. The aim of the scheme is to improve the availability of local electric vehicle (EV) charging infrastructure for residents without off-street (private) parking..

In 2022 it was announced that ORCS funding would continue, including a total of £20 million funding for 2023/24. Additionally, amendments to the scheme were made to ensure:
1.    More local authorities would be able to benefit from the funding
2.    The customer experience of charging would be improved
3.    Charge point installations could take place on more types of suitable land
 
ORCS Funding Summary
•    Available for lamppost, car parks & street furniture charge points
•    Open to relevant local authorities throughout the UK for areas without off-street parking
•    Can fund up to 60% of procurement and installation costs
•    Projects with a delivery timeframe of up to the end of the 2023/24 financial year (31st March 2024) will be considered
